For the academic year 2023-2024, the average acceptance rate of Most Searched Graduate In South Carolina is 57.43%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 20.18%.
A total of 162,308 have applied, 93,221 admitted, and 18,813 students have enrolled one of Most Searched Graduate In South Carolina.
Clemson University is the tightest school to admit with 38.00% acceptance rate, and University of South Carolina-Columbia has the second lowest acceptance rate of 61.00%.
